What are the business hours?

It's important to note that there are no standard business hours, which vary depending on several factors, such as the type of business and municipal regulations. Hours are often established through agreements between merchants, associations, and unions.

In general, the most common business hours are Monday to Saturday, from 9 am to 6 pm, applied in various commercial establishments, such as computer stores, among others.

On the other hand, in shopping malls, opening hours tend to start around 10 or 11 am and last until 8 pm.

In some Brazilian cities, the so-called "English week" is adopted, where business hours begin at 1 p.m. on Mondays. Typically, businesses in these cities remain open until 7 p.m.

In markets, it is common for this time to be much longer, starting around 7 am and going until 8 pm or 9 pm.

Therefore, everything depends directly on the type of business and the rules established by the municipality for its operation.

Supermarket Business Hours

One establishment that has different business hours is the supermarket. This is because it needs to establish a schedule that's convenient for everyone when shopping for essential items.

Generally speaking, business hours are from 7:00 AM to 10:00 PM. However, it's important to note that these hours can vary depending on the region and type of market. In some areas, for example, establishments may close at 9:00 PM. Additionally, it's common to see different opening hours on Sundays, with closing times occurring around 2:00 PM.

On special dates, this time may extend until midnight or later.

Bank Business Hours

Banks have different business hours when serving the public, which can cause confusion, especially for those who are not used to it.

Opening hours are from 10am to 4pm for general service, Monday to Friday.

In addition, it is possible to carry out operations at self-service terminals (ATMs) during extended hours, from 6 am to 10 pm.

Post Office Business Hours

The established business hours for post offices throughout the country are Monday to Friday, from 8 am to 5 pm.

In some municipalities, specific agencies may also operate on Saturdays, from 9 am to 1 pm.

Lottery Business Hours

According to the law, the business hours of lottery outlets in the country are from 8 am to 6 pm, Monday to Friday, and from 8 am to 12 pm on Saturdays.

However, there is flexibility that allows some establishments to operate from 9am to 1pm on Saturdays or extend their hours to 9am to 6pm from Monday to Saturday.

Some precautions regarding business hours

For both merchants and customers, there are necessary business hours to consider to ensure proper operation and consumption. Here's what you need to consider.

If you are a business owner

  • Always publicize your opening hours everywhere (website, flyers, customer service channels, etc.). It's also important to have a sign advertising your hours at your business.
  • Always notify us if there are any changes to our business hours, such as holidays and other days that may be necessary.
  • To ensure your business runs smoothly, set operating hours based on your region, customers, target audience, and the type of service you offer.
  • If you need to close early on any day for any reason, issue a statement on all channels explaining the incident.
  • Be clear with your information. State the days and hours of operation, as well as whether or not the business will be open during lunch hours.

If you are a customer

  • Always check the company's communication channels for opening hours.
  • Check that there have been no changes to business hours before going to the store.
  • Check how it operates on weekends, holidays, and other occasions.
  • If you're not sure about the opening hours, go to the location and ask about their opening hours. This way, you'll know your visit will be more productive.
